    Critical AMI BMC Vulnerability: Patch Your ASUS Workstation Now

    April 25, 2025

    Critical AMI BMC Vulnerability: Patch Your ASUS Workstation Now

    Veteran PC users are likely familiar with encountering messages from American Megatrends International (AMI) during system startup. AMI stands as a leading provider of BIOS and UEFI firmware solutions …
